Work Experience for School Pupils

We welcome school pupils on work experience programmes who are looking to gain an insight into a career in the legal sector. Our work experience programme is predominantly shadowing and assisting the clerking team. There may be an opportunity for school pupils to spend time with our finance and marketing teams, however this will depend on a variety of factors and cannot be guaranteed.

We do not offer barrister shadowing outside of our mini-pupillage programme. School pupils are not eligible for mini-pupillages. It may be possible to take school pupils to a court or tribunal hearing during their time with us, but again this will depend on a variety of factors and cannot be guaranteed.

We only have a limited number of work experience spaces available each year. Some of the work is likely to be physical in nature, so please let us know if this will present any difficulty and we will make reasonable adjustments.
